Alitalia resumes flights to South Korea and China

0 751

Starting with June 4 2015, Alitalia will resume flights to South Korea, after better than 20 years break, with the new route between Rome and Seoul. In 2013 trade between Italy and South Korea was about 7,5 billion.

Starting with 1th May 2015, in collaboration with the Expo Milano 2015 opening, Alitalia will also inaugurate a new one flight between Milan Malpensa and Shanghai, the largest city of the People's Republic of China according to the number of inhabitants. The flight will operate during the Milan 2015 Expo.

New Alitalia flights to Shanghai and Seoul will be honored by aircraft Airbus A330 configured in three classes: Business, Premium Economy and Economy, with a total of 250 seats.

By the end of this year, Alitalia will resume flights to Beijing with a direct flight from Rome. In 2013, trade between Italy and China was about 33 billion.
